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

 
Reply to this topicStart new topic
> [PHP][MySQL]Czytanie danych z bazy danych
coolorzel
post 18.07.2013, 00:06:43
Post #1





Grupa: Zarejestrowani
Postów: 12
Pomógł: 0
Dołączył: 2.03.2013

Ostrzeżenie: (0%)
-----


Witam.

Mam mały problem, gdyż napisałem panel logowania, rejestracji i rang, lecz nie mogę zrozumieć jak zrpbić, by user mógł pisać formularze, które będą wysyłały informacje do innej tabeli i czytały właśnie jego dane z tej nowe tabeli, by mógł je edytować


Jeżeli nie rozumiecie, chętnie wytłumaczę.
Go to the top of the page
+Quote Post
-Gość-
post 18.07.2013, 05:46:41
Post #2





Goście







Nie rozumiemy.
A czego Ty dokladnie nie mozesz zrozumiec?
Go to the top of the page
+Quote Post
-Gość-
post 18.07.2013, 11:55:33
Post #3





Goście







Mam tabelę users i wiem jak odnieść się do tego, żeby edytował swój profil, a nie kogoś innego, lecz nie mam zielonego pojęcia jak zrobić, by user wypełnione dane w tabeli mógł edytować, lecz ta tabela to już nie users, lecz 'test1', w której mam takie dane jak:
id, o sobie
Go to the top of the page
+Quote Post
nospor
post 18.07.2013, 11:57:29
Post #4





Grupa: Moderatorzy
Postów: 36 557
Pomógł: 6315
Dołączył: 27.12.2004




A co za roznica czy tabela nazywa sie users czy test1.... jeden grzyb, robisz dokłądnie tak samo.


--------------------

"Myśl, myśl, myśl..." - Kubuś Puchatek || "Manual, manual, manual..." - Kubuś Programista
"Szukaj, szukaj, szukaj..." - Kubuś Odkrywca || "Debuguj, debuguj, debuguj..." - Kubuś Developer

Go to the top of the page
+Quote Post
Turson
post 18.07.2013, 12:17:26
Post #5





Grupa: Zarejestrowani
Postów: 4 291
Pomógł: 829
Dołączył: 14.02.2009
Skąd: łódź

Ostrzeżenie: (0%)
-----


Cytat(Gość @ 18.07.2013, 12:55:33 ) *
Mam tabelę users i wiem jak odnieść się do tego, żeby edytował swój profil, a nie kogoś innego, lecz nie mam zielonego pojęcia jak zrobić, by user wypełnione dane w tabeli mógł edytować, lecz ta tabela to już nie users, lecz 'test1', w której mam takie dane jak:
id, o sobie

Lepszym rozwiązaniem by było:
id, id_usera, o sobie

Dzięki temu możesz powiązać "o sobie" z danym userem - wybierz o_sobie z test gdzie id_usera=

Ten post edytował TursoN 18.07.2013, 12:19:06
Go to the top of the page
+Quote Post
--coolorzel--
post 18.07.2013, 12:54:56
Post #6





Goście







TursoN
dasz przykład kodu i tabeli sql??
Go to the top of the page
+Quote Post
Turson
post 18.07.2013, 14:18:41
Post #7





Grupa: Zarejestrowani
Postów: 4 291
Pomógł: 829
Dołączył: 14.02.2009
Skąd: łódź

Ostrzeżenie: (0%)
-----


Podałem już przykład tabeli.

Tabela 'users'
id, login

Tabela 'test'
id, o_mnie, id_usera

Zakładam, że user się loguje. Pobierasz jest id z tabeli users i np. definiujesz np jako $user_id

Jeśli chodzi o edycję profilu to np.
SELECT `o_mnie` FROM `test` WHERE id_usera=$user_id
Go to the top of the page
+Quote Post

Reply to this topicStart new topic
1 Użytkowników czyta ten temat (1 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Wersja Lo-Fi Aktualny czas: 19.07.2025 - 11:22